Mathematical model of cancer with radiotherapy and chemotherapy treatments

Received 16 Feb 2024, Accepted 02 May 2024, Published online: 17 May 2024
 

Abstract

The typical treatment for tumor involves a combination of radiation therapy and chemotherapy. In this study, we explore a mathematical model based on proliferation and diffusion, considering the impacts of both radiotherapeutic and chemotherapeutic treatments. The mathematical model is formulated as a system of partial differential equations, accompanied by initial, boundary, and free boundary conditions. Existence and uniqueness of this mathematical problem are obtained by developing an iteration algorithm in this paper.
